The Egyptian Red Crescent launched its 112th "Zad Al-Ezza... From Egypt to Gaza" convoy today, Thursday, carrying a number of trucks of urgent humanitarian aid destined for the Gaza Strip, as part of its ongoing efforts as a national mechanism for coordinating the entry of aid into Gaza.
On its 112th day, the "Zad Al-Ezza" convoy carried tons of comprehensive humanitarian aid, including more than 118,000 food baskets, 755 tons of flour, more than 970 tons of medicines, medical and relief supplies, more than 160 tons of personal hygiene items, and approximately 1,580 tons of petroleum products.
In response to the severe weather conditions affecting the Gaza Strip, the Egyptian Red Crescent dispatched essential winter supplies to Gaza, including approximately 30,970 winter clothing items and 920 blankets, as part of Egypt's ongoing efforts to support its brothers and sisters in Gaza.
